reCAPTCHAとは、Googleが提供するセキュリティシステムで、ウェブサイト上でユーザーが人間か自動プログラム(ボット)かを判別するための機能です。
不正アクセスやスパム、悪意のある自動化ツールからウェブサイトを保護するために使われます。
reCAPTCHAには、画像選択や文字認識、チェックボックスへのクリック、さらにはユーザーの行動を解析する「invisible reCAPTCHA」など、さまざまなバージョンがあります。
例えば、「すべての交通信号の画像を選択してください」といったテストをユーザーに提示し、正確に選択できるかを判定することで、人間かボットかを識別します。
近年のreCAPTCHA v3では、ユーザーの行動をスコアリングしてボットの可能性を判断し、よりユーザーフレンドリーな認証を実現しています。
このようにreCAPTCHAは、ウェブサイトのセキュリティ対策として広く利用されており、ユーザー体験を損なわないように設計されています。
用語辞典ページに戻る